Prince Harry and Meghan Markle have once again found themselves at the center of royal controversy, this time accused of overshadowing the birthday celebrations of their nephew, Prince George. The criticism comes after a series of events that royal commentators have labeled as “carefully controlled” attempts to upstage the young prince’s special day.

 

The controversy erupted on July 22, 2024, when a new photograph of Prince George, taken by his mother, Princess Kate, was released to mark his 11th birthday. The charming image, intended to celebrate the occasion, was overshadowed by two significant moves from the Sussexes. On the same day, Prince Harry announced that the Invictus Games would be held in Birmingham, UK, in 2027, while Meghan Markle was spotted out in Montecito with actress Kimberly Williams-Paisley.

 

Former GB News host Dan Wootton was among the first to criticize the timing of Harry’s announcement. On his Outspoken programme, Wootton stated, “This is also really terrible. Prince Harry upstaged young Prince George’s lovely birthday release of those pictures by Catherine Middleton by announcing on the same day that the Invictus Games are going to be held in Birmingham in 2027. It does just show you how pathetic Prince Harry is. He knew it was George’s birthday, he knew the picture was going to be released. He wants to steal the thunder with his Invictus Games announcement. It’s just pathetic gameplaying yet again.”

Royal commentator Angela Levin echoed Wootton’s sentiments, suggesting that Meghan Markle’s actions were deliberate. “It’s such a shame. I think Meghan likes to do that, we’ve seen that so many times. Every time the Royal Family do something, she has to do something just before and it’s all carefully controlled. I’ve been told many times she knows exactly what she’s doing, it’s not a mistake, she’s very cautious. And Harry I suppose was told this is what he had to do,” Levin remarked.

 

The accusations against the Sussexes come at a time when their relationship with the rest of the royal family is already strained. Critics argue that the couple’s actions show a lack of respect and consideration for family events and milestones. This latest incident has only added fuel to the fire, reinforcing the perception that Harry and Meghan are more focused on their public image and personal projects than maintaining harmonious family relations.

 

Supporters of Harry and Meghan, however, have defended the couple, arguing that the timing of the Invictus Games announcement was coincidental and not intended to overshadow Prince George’s birthday. They point out that the logistics of announcing an international event like the Invictus Games are complex and that the date may have been chosen for practical reasons unrelated to the royal birthday.
